Output e76c4ef89817e72051cc7c2f9c52f60df9ff11e1ebde9e9e6762b9fc97a32075:9

value
1618876
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f842ba8cbfc7615292e164aa8c0ca8717bd5a5e OP_EQUALVERIFY OP_CHECKSIG
address
13seHKPw9a7RNAhXFeLLja834Mm56S9r4p
transaction
e76c4ef89817e72051cc7c2f9c52f60df9ff11e1ebde9e9e6762b9fc97a32075
confirmations
135549
spent
true